## Step 4: Configure the assignment service

Splitgate (our A/B experiment assignment service) reads its config from `.env` in the deploy root. Set `ASSIGN_PORT` to 8140, `BUCKET_SALT_VERSION` to match the current experiment ledger, and `STICKY_TTL` to 86400 unless product says otherwise. Never reuse a salt version across environments — it skews bucketing and invalidates results. Verify with `splitctl check` before starting the service. Once the checks pass, add the ledger API secret on the next line.

sealed setting: VAULT_KEY20=69e2a0b23f1a79fbf692

## Changelog — Font vendoring defaults changed

As of this release, the Bracken UI build no longer fetches third-party fonts at build time. All typefaces used by the Lanternwell suite are now vendored into the repo under a dedicated assets directory, and the fetch step is skipped by default. If you're onboarding, nothing to install — the fonts travel with the checkout. The build flags controlling this behavior are listed below.

settings of hadup-yafog:
LAMAEL_PIN=3761
LAMAEL_TENANT=istmir
LAMAEL_METRICS_HOST=metrics.lamael.plorvasys.test
LAMAEL_SEAL=seal_8ea68500
LAMAEL_STANDBY_TEAM=fraok

Finance Review Summary — Headcount Plan

For the incoming director: next year's headcount plan holds total staff roughly flat, with six additions in the Norwick service hub offset by attrition elsewhere. Contractor spend declines 10%. The plan assumes no change to the Pellan division structure through mid-year. One item is restricted to director level and follows below:

board note of kageg-bahof: The renewal with Holwynax Holdings closes at $2 million a year, 5 percent below the last contract. Project Ulaath slips by two quarters because of the supplier delay.